#242> It was in 1998 that USB made some real headway, courtesy of the iMac G3, the first computer to ship with only USB ports for external devices (there were no serial or parallel ports). Um, no? The iMac had an Ethernet port, a phone jack for an internal modem, and TWO FIREWIRE PORTS. And Microphone and Speaker jacks.
The first iMac was USB only. https://en.wikipedia.org/wiki/IMac_G3#Specifications
- 2x USB
- 1x 10/100 Ethernet
- 1x phone jack
- Infrared port
- 1x audio input
- 1x audio output†
- 2x headphone ports
†I thought it had two front headphone ports so that two students could share a computer in school labs, but googling for that suggests it was probably a later revision feature.
EDIT: It did indeed have 2 headphone ports on the front: https://en.wikipedia.org/wiki/IMac_G3#/media/File:IMac_G3_Bo...

#248I think people really need to think about USB Type A in the context of the connectors it was 'competing' with: DSUB9 (VGA), RS-232 (serial), DB-25 (parallel), PS/2 (keyboard/mouse). These were, by modern standards, complete garbage connectors. Huge. Didn't stay plugged in securely unless the connector had screws. Only went one way. USB 1 stayed plugged in, required no screws, had higher bandwidth than any data port y…
The only exception I know of is that Apple Desktop Bus (mini-DIN) had been designed (by Woz !) to be supposed to be hot-pluggable but Apple cheaped out on overcurrent protection so it never was.
Edit: I forgot: in a MIDI connection there is an opto-coupler behind the receiving end, to electrically separate devices.
